Job description
Reporting to the Machine Shop Director (And dotted line to the Assemble Director & MRO VP), the Maintenance Manager is the direct manager of the maintenance team and responsible for the availability of the Production and Assembly means of OE and MRO as well as responsible for the leadership and development of the Maintenance functions.
As Maintenance Manager you will be responsible for:
Performance management:
• Overall performance, development and maintenance of production technical resources/assets and capability (equipment, environment and personnel) for the Machine Shop, Assembly and MRO.
• Managing the maintenance budget and ensure effective internal and external resources allocation.
• Monitor and analyze performance indicators (MTBF, MTTR, etc.).
• Develop/update maintenance processes and procedures.
Team Supervision:
• Lead, train, coach a team of Maintenance technicians and Engineers.
• Develop the skills of the team members in line with the production means currently at SLS TOR, to be received and new technologies (Sensors, WinCC etc.)
• Ensure a strong working relationship with your colleagues and customers, both internally and externally to the business.
Strategy and Optimization:
• Develop a strategy to improve the availability of production means using tools such as Problem solving, FMEA etc.
• Participate to the efforts leading to SLS TOR competitiveness improvement by driving efficiency and cost improvements whilst ensuring delivery, quality and internal customer satisfaction.
• Developing and executing a roadmap towards Condition Based Maintenance by integrating innovative technologies (IoT for instance).
• Participate to the selection of Investment selection (Machines etc.)
Safety and Compliance:
• Adhere to regulatory requirements and ensuring that the team and the external contractors are adhering to the Safran Landing Systems Toronto HSE rules
• Ensure equipment compliance with regulatory requirements.
